Apprentice IT Support Technician HALESOWEN COLLEGE OF FURTHER EDUCATION

To work as part of the College’s IT Support Team to provide first and second line hardware and software support to all users of IT across the College’s growing number of sites. As part of your position you will be installing and configuring IT equipment including computers, laptops, mobile phones, desktop phones, printers, network devices (including switches) and other peripherals.

What will the apprentice be doing?

  • Recognising when an issue requires escalation to the Senior Technicians, Network Manager, or external agencies
  • Liaising with staff to enable the effective delivery of the curriculum, including informal one on one and small group training on the use of IT equipment
  • Provide support to visiting speakers and external events held within college
  • Providing technical support to staff and students with hardware and software problems
  • Routine maintenance of IT equipment including the replacement of consumable items
  • Installing and updating software as necessary
  • To ensure that projectors and interactive displays are available to staff and provide support for their effective use
  • To ensure that the safety of the equipment conforms with the Health and Safety Act and the Electricity at Work regulations
  • Assisting the Network manager and senior technicians with keeping logs of equipment faults, equipment serial numbers, movement of IT equipment and software
  • Ensuring security and protection of college systems to prevent misuse and malware

What training will the apprentice take and what qualification will the apprentice get at the end?

  • IT Solutions Technician Level 3 Apprenticeship Standard
  • You will be expected to attend Halesowen College one day per week, to work towards your qualification
  • You will be allocated with an assessor who will visit you within the workplace every 8 weeks
